Here are the 5 tips I came up with for beginners based on my experience:
-
Don’t rely on just one predictor. Try a few different ones and see which one works best for you.
-
Do your own research on the players. The predictor is just a tool, and you need to have your own understanding of the game.
-
Keep an eye on the fixtures. A player’s price can change a lot depending on the teams they’re playing against.
-
Be patient. The price changes don’t happen overnight, and you need to wait and see how things develop.

-
Don’t be afraid to make mistakes. Everyone makes mistakes when they’re starting out, and that’s how you learn.
